Systems Software Developer and Integrator (JSE)-Journeyman
Job Description
The position is a Journeyman level Systems Software Developer and Integrator (JSE) within AMEWAS, supporting Battlespace Modeling & Simulation. It is an on-site role at Naval Air Station Patuxent River, MD, with a salary range of USD 117,200 to 136,100 per year.
Responsibilities
- Incorporates software releases into the JSE development lifecycle and DevOps project structures
- Identifies JSE product dependencies and how they interact with other products
- Diagnoses and characterizes issues to enable resolution by development teams
- Conducts regular integration testing events and communicates test findings to multiple teams
- Produces and maintains integration test documentation
- Executes hotfix changes and builds to address critical issues
- Merges GitLab work into baseline development trunks
- Operates in a dynamic, edge-of-technology environment to support frontline warfighters
- Demonstrates flexibility, foresight and an understanding of impact on overall success
Requirements
- A Bachelor's Degree in Computer Science or Engineering, or a related field such as Information Technology, Mathematics, Physics, Aerospace, Computer, Software Systems, Electrical or Electronic engineering; or six years of additional related work experience (nine years total) may substitute for a Bachelor's Degree
- Degree from an accredited college or university as recognized by the U.S. Department of Education
- Three years of relevant work experience
- Three years of experience coding with C++, Lua and/or Python
- Experience developing on Windows and Linux
- Experience with Ansible
- Experience with Git and GitLab
- Experience troubleshooting, debugging, maintaining and improving existing software code
- Excellent personal communication skills
- Ability to work in a flexible and energetic-paced environment
- Ability to learn quickly
- Willingness to obtain and maintain DoD security clearance, including potential Secret and Top Secret levels as contract needs
